OpenShot 1.4.3 released with new theme, 3D animations and numerous improvements

OpenShot 1.4.3

OpenShot is a powerful open source video editor, that presents the user an easy-to-use interface, clear controls and numerous features (multiple tracks, animations, effects, transitions, 3D animated titles, etc).

OpenShot 1.4.3 has been released "after many months of hard work and dedication", adding features, enhancements and various refinements.

The new 1.4.3 release brings improved transition handling, allowing users to hassle-free utilize transitions applied to numerous clips, process rendered and previewed smoothly without further tweaks, adjustments, etc; adding a transition between two clips is to be performed by dragging & dropping the clips to the Track area, action followed by (under Transitions) dragging & dropping a transition between the two clips (the result: dragging the sequence line or clicking the play button from the Video Preview, generates an accurate properly rendered transition-enabled clip).

Usually, when creating clips, adding 3D animations (for key words, titles, etc), brings an "exotic" pleasant-to-the-eye look & feel, aspect already implemented in OpenShot; yet, the 1.4.3 release introduces new 3D animations, such as Realistic Earth (drawing a fancy line from one city to another on top of a high-quality rendered Earth), Exploding Text (in-depth manner of "destroying" a piece of text, generating a massive amount of text "particles"), Dissolving Text (into a blue-ish "fog"), etc.

In order to set a specific speed level (2X, 2X, 4X, 5X) for animated titles, navigate to OpenShot-->Title-->New Animated Title-->select Animation length

Holo is a newly implemented theme, that pushes a dark look into OpenShot, featuring black-ish transparent containers (for transitions, etc), blue-ish highlight lines and sequence line, theme suitable for both dark themes (thus generating a "full" dark look) and light themes (expressing a fancy contrast).

The Holo theme can be selected under OpenShot-->Edit-->Preferences-->General-->Default theme-->holo

Option to simultaneously apply effects to multiple tracks/clips, new transitions, refreshed dependencies (OpenShot 1.4.3 requires Blender 2.62 and above, Blender 2.62 is available via Ubuntu 12.04's Ubuntu Software Center) and a solid amount of bug fixes, come to deliver a strengthened polished OpenShot release.

How do we install OpenShot 1.4.3?
Add the following official PPA (Lucid, Natty, Oneiric, Precise, Quantal)

sudo add-apt-repository ppa:openshot.developers/ppa

s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install openshot
